14章 RAG技术从基础到精通 打造高精准AI应用

107 阅读5分钟

"【14章】RAG全栈技术从基础到精通,打造高精准AI应用"这个标题暗示了一个全面深入的教程,旨在教授读者如何利用RAG(Retrieval-Augmented Generation,检索增强生成)技术构建高效的AI应用。RAG是一种结合了信息检索和文本生成的技术框架,能够提高生成任务的准确性。以下是对这一主题可能涵盖的内容进行概述:

14章 RAG技术从基础到精通 打造高精准AI应用

可能涉及的主题

1. RAG简介

  • 解释什么是RAG及其工作原理。
  • RAG与传统NLP模型的区别。

2. 基础知识

  • 自然语言处理(NLP)基础知识。
  • 深度学习基础,特别是对Transformer架构的理解。

3. 数据准备

  • 如何收集、清洗以及准备用于训练的数据集。
  • 使用公开数据集或创建自定义数据集的方法。

4. 环境搭建

  • 安装必要的软件和库,如Python、PyTorch、Transformers等。
  • 配置开发环境,包括GPU支持设置。

5. 检索组件

  • 介绍不同的信息检索技术,如TF-IDF、BM25。
  • 实现基于向量相似度的文档检索系统。

6. 生成组件

  • 训练和微调预训练的语言模型。
  • 使用Hugging Face Transformers库进行文本生成。

7. RAG模型整合

  • 将检索和生成两个组件集成到一个统一的框架中。
  • 调整参数以优化性能。

8. 应用实例

  • 构建特定领域的AI应用案例研究,例如智能客服、内容摘要等。
  • 探讨如何在实际项目中应用RAG技术解决具体问题。

9. 性能评估

  • 学习如何评估模型的准确性和效率。
  • 常用的评价指标和方法。

10. 部署与服务化

  • 将训练好的模型部署为API服务。
  • 使用Docker、Kubernetes等工具实现模型的容器化和服务化。

11. 维护与更新

  • 模型上线后的维护策略。
  • 根据用户反馈持续改进模型。

12. 最佳实践与常见挑战

  • 分享成功案例中的最佳实践。
  • 解决部署过程中遇到的典型问题。

13. 未来趋势

  • 探讨RAG技术的发展方向。
  • 新兴技术和研究进展。

14. 项目实战

  • 通过一个完整的项目示例,从头到尾展示如何运用所学知识构建一个真实的高精准AI应用。

学习建议

  • 理论与实践相结合:确保理解每个概念的同时,也要动手实践每一个步骤。
  • 加入社区:参与相关的论坛和社交媒体群组,和其他学习者或专家交流心得。
  • 持续关注最新发展:由于AI领域发展迅速,保持对新论文、新技术的关注是非常重要的。

2025-03-20 09:02·自在可乐krYfxm

获课:keyouit.xyz/14241/

获取ZY↑↑方打开链接↑↑

"【14章】RAG全栈技术从基础到精通,打造高精准AI应用"这个标题暗示了一个全面深入的教程,旨在教授读者如何利用RAG(Retrieval-Augmented Generation,检索增强生成)技术构建高效的AI应用。RAG是一种结合了信息检索和文本生成的技术框架,能够提高生成任务的准确性。以下是对这一主题可能涵盖的内容进行概述:

可能涉及的主题

1. RAG简介

  • 解释什么是RAG及其工作原理。
  • RAG与传统NLP模型的区别。

2. 基础知识

  • 自然语言处理(NLP)基础知识。
  • 深度学习基础,特别是对Transformer架构的理解。

3. 数据准备

  • 如何收集、清洗以及准备用于训练的数据集。
  • 使用公开数据集或创建自定义数据集的方法。

4. 环境搭建

  • 安装必要的软件和库,如Python、PyTorch、Transformers等。
  • 配置开发环境,包括GPU支持设置。

5. 检索组件

  • 介绍不同的信息检索技术,如TF-IDF、BM25。
  • 实现基于向量相似度的文档检索系统。

6. 生成组件

  • 训练和微调预训练的语言模型。
  • 使用Hugging Face Transformers库进行文本生成。

7. RAG模型整合

  • 将检索和生成两个组件集成到一个统一的框架中。
  • 调整参数以优化性能。

8. 应用实例

  • 构建特定领域的AI应用案例研究,例如智能客服、内容摘要等。
  • 探讨如何在实际项目中应用RAG技术解决具体问题。

9. 性能评估

  • 学习如何评估模型的准确性和效率。
  • 常用的评价指标和方法。

10. 部署与服务化

  • 将训练好的模型部署为API服务。
  • 使用Docker、Kubernetes等工具实现模型的容器化和服务化。

11. 维护与更新

  • 模型上线后的维护策略。
  • 根据用户反馈持续改进模型。

12. 最佳实践与常见挑战

  • 分享成功案例中的最佳实践。
  • 解决部署过程中遇到的典型问题。

13. 未来趋势

  • 探讨RAG技术的发展方向。
  • 新兴技术和研究进展。

14. 项目实战

  • 通过一个完整的项目示例,从头到尾展示如何运用所学知识构建一个真实的高精准AI应用。

学习建议

  • 理论与实践相结合:确保理解每个概念的同时,也要动手实践每一个步骤。
  • 加入社区:参与相关的论坛和社交媒体群组,和其他学习者或专家交流心得。
  • 持续关注最新发展:由于AI领域发展迅速,保持对新论文、新技术的关注是非常重要的。